The concept was called a negative coupon convertible, and Trott cajoled a former Harvard finance professor working on the capital markets desk at Goldman to design it. He wanted to create a security that paid Berkshire to borrow money, the opposite of how a loan typically works, with the catch being that investors also would get the right to buy Berkshire stock in the future at a lower premium than in a standard convertible debt offering. BDT has three other partners: San Orr, a longtime colleague at Goldman Sachs and the key emissary to the Walton family; Dan Jester, another ex-Goldmanite and a prized Paulson lieutenant at Treasury during the financial crisis; and William Bush (no relation to the political clan), a lawyer and longtime Trott confidant who is nearing retirement.
